## Configuring PairLoom

PairLoom is our matching service, and yes, the GC pauses are real — if your plugin sees 200ms stalls during peak matching, it's almost always heap pressure. Tune it in your .env: set GC_TARGET_PAUSE_MS=50 and MATCH_HEAP_LIMIT_MB=2048 as sane starting points. If you're running the profiler sidecar, also flip GC_TRACE=true so we can actually see what's happening. One catch: the metrics exporter won't ship traces upstream without authenticating, so add its credential on the very next line.

vault entry, yajop-bafop: ARCHIVE_KEY3=8d4

# CastCheck Validator — Runbook

Service: CastCheck, validates podcast RSS/Atom feeds for the Norvell platform.

On alert: check queue depth first. If above 10k, scale workers via the Helmsley console. Stuck jobs usually mean a malformed feed looping the parser — kill the worker, the feed gets quarantined automatically.

Never restart the dedup cache mid-run; it drops in-flight hashes.

Escalation: page the on-call in #castcheck-ops.

Dashboards, quarantine list, and full procedures are on the internal page below.

operations page: https://jenkins.zemvarcloud.local/job/merge_requests/repo/build/73930b4b30f0a8ed

Step 6: Deploying Fixturely, the test-data factory library, to the internal package registry. After CI finishes, confirm the generated fixtures pass the determinism check — the same seed must always produce identical records, or downstream test suites will flake. If the check fails, do not force-publish; roll back to the previous tag and page the Fixturely owners during business hours. Once the check is green, run the publish script from the release host. The script will prompt for the signing key shown below.

rollout seal: bky4_x7Gc

Procurement has qualified two candidates, Morvale Plastics and Drennat Mouldings, and expects pilot orders within eight weeks. Please provision for dual tooling costs, higher near-term unit prices during qualification, and a safety-stock build at the Ashbourne Fen warehouse. Detailed cost schedules will follow in the appendix. The confidential note below sets out the associated sourcing plan.

internal memo for kawip-hadug: Headcount on the Wenwyn team goes from 7 to 140 by the end of January. Gross margin on Wenwyn came in at 20 percent against a plan of 15 percent.